French Tutors

French tutoring develops proficiency across speaking, listening, reading, and writing, helping students communicate effectively in French and engage with Francophone cultures. The tutor works through grammar concepts, vocabulary building, pronunciation refinement, and conversational practice, tailored to the student's level. Sessions use authentic materials—songs, films, articles, literature—to develop language skills in cultural context. Students learn to express complex ideas in French, to understand diverse French accents and registers, and to appreciate Francophone cultural perspectives. The result is both linguistic ability and cultural competence.
